Please help me out - I have a 69 saloon which won't start! I replaced the points and plugs earlier on in the week and this morning went to adjust the points gap - he started fine then but I've just gone out to take him out and now he wont start at all - he turns over but doesn;t fire and I dont think it can be the points as there's no spark there - please help - he is my daily driver and I need him for work tomorrow!

As grainger says, check all the wires, and make sure that the nylon bushes are in the right place. I've answered a question similar to this before, and I think the bush was the culprit. I only know, because I had wired my distributer up wrongly before. Sadly, I didn't notice until I had replaced half the ignition system.
